4. Replaceable Diaphragm

One of the biggest advantages of the KD series design is maintenance. Over time, all air pump diaphragms wear out and lose elasticity. The KD-A180 is constructed to allow users to open the casing and replace the rubber diaphragm, extending the life of the pump indefinitely. Simple Operation : Typically features a single outlet
